Output 8dcbb4b6e17f02aa56213a2c7e30d90d19b0127e06481ecbcf3628983583703a:3

value
149107675
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dba1d4e68f1b1b7d7e0d507098bc5ae0192f79e6 OP_EQUAL
address
3MiKmpBZN53H3dqh2ztZkycE3JASp7c6AU
transaction
8dcbb4b6e17f02aa56213a2c7e30d90d19b0127e06481ecbcf3628983583703a
spent
true